1. Identify KRAs of Software developer

Key Result Areas” or KRAs refer to general areas of outputs or outcomes for which the department’s role is responsible. You also need to understand some definitions: Key performance areas, Key performance indicators.

2. Identify job objectives

Do you set up objectives for Software developer?

• 1 month.
• 3 months.
• 6 months.
• 12 months.

3. Identify job description of Software developer

You can use some tasks of Software developer as follows:

• Write, modify, and debug software for client applications.
• Use source debuggers and visual development environments.
• Perform coding to written technical specifications.
• Investigate, analyze and document reported defects.
• Write code to create single-threaded or user interface event driven applications, either stand-alone and those which access servers or services.

4. Job standards/procedures

It is very difficult to appraise Software developer if you have not job standards, job procedures for this positions.

Try it now:

• How to do each task?
• How to measure performance of each task?
• How to control/monitor each step of a process?

5. Software developer evaluation forms

You can you types of performance evaluation as follows:

• Peer form.
• Self appraisal form.
• Customer/Other department appraisal form.
• Superior appraisal form.
• Subordinate appraisal form.

